[13 December 2004] GAZA CITY,(Saba) - Five Israeli soldiers were killed when Palestinian militants blew up a tunnel under an army post in Gaza, as jailed intifada leader Marwan Barghuti pulled out of the Palestinian elections.
The attack at the Israeli-controlled Rafah border crossing was the latest sign of a resurgence of violence in Gaza that has clouded hopes for peace between Israelis and Palestinians after Yasser Arafat's death on Nov 11.
Hamas and a group known as the Fatah Hawks claimed responsibility. They said they had burrowed for 600 yards to reach an Israeli post at the Rafah border and set off the massive bomb.
